Join Red Bull Ventures’ team as a Fund Operations Expert, where you’ll drive startup founder support, organize engaging community initiatives, and manage our IT toolset and back office. In this dynamic role, you’ll play a crucial role in ensuring strong community engagement, operational excellence, and effective support for founders and Red Bull Ventures’ wider ecosystem.

FOUNDER SUPPORT & VALUE CREATION
- Facilitate portfolio company onboarding through communications and marketing activities.
- Provide hands-on support through introductions, resources, and advice for portfolio company needs.
IT TOOL & DATA LANDSCAPE MANAGEMENT
- Implement and maintain fund management software, CRM platforms, data rooms, and communication tools.
- Ensure team training and seamless user experience for all technology systems supporting the fund and founder communities.
BACK-OFFICE & ADMINISTRATIVE SUPPORT
- Provide administrative services and manage meetings for interactions with internal and external stakeholders.
- Support fund operations with document management and regulatory compliance throughout the investment process and in preparation for reporting.
COMMUNITY BUILDING & ENGAGEMENT
- Organize events that strengthen Red Bull Venture’s relationships among startups and the VC ecosystem.
- Sort, qualify and answer inbound deal flow according to Red Bull’s strategic agenda.
EXPERIENCE
Your areas of knowledge and expertise
that matter most for this role:
- University degree in a Business/Communications/Marketing related field.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ills in German and especially in English.
- Collaborative, approachable, and passionate about creating an inclusive, welcoming environment for all stakeholders.
- A highly organized and independent work style with the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, demanding environment.
- Passion for innovation, technology, and the Red Bull brand.
- Travel 0-10%
